WebJul 14, 2024 · 4. Bottom Line. Phenylephrine relieves congestion of the nasal passages and is found in many cold and flu remedies. There is some controversy over whether it works at the dosages usually found in over-the-counter products. Sleeplessness is a common side effect. WebJun 27, 2007 · While the antihistamine component is relatively harmless, decongestants such as pseudoephedrine or phenylephrine are poorly tolerated by dogs and cats. Very small quantities can seriously harm ...

WebJul 11, 2024 · National Center for Biotechnology Information WebClinical Findings: Pseudoephedrine and ephedrine overdose can result in mainly sympathomimetic effects, including agitation, hyperactivity, mydriasis, tachycardia, hypertension, sinus arrhythmias, anxiety, tremors, hyperthermia, head bobbing, hiding, and vomiting. WebThe dose for dogs is: 1 milligram per 1 pound of body weight, or 1 mg/lb. Round down! Do not exceed 50 mg per dose, even for large dogs. Benadryl can be given every 8 to 12 hours (two or three times a day), not to exceed 3 to 5 days duration, unless directed otherwise by a veterinarian.
